<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">:root {
  --main-color: #004898;
}
.txtcolor-004898 {
  color: #004898;
}
.txtcolor-818181 {
  color: #818181;
}

.txtcolor-000000 {
  color: #000000;
}

.txtcolor-333333 {
  color: #333333;
}

.txtcolor-434343 {
  color: #434343;
}

.txtcolor-464646 {
  color: #464646;
}

.txtcolor-ababab {
  color: #ababab;
}

.txtcolor-ffffff {
  color: #ffffff;
}

.txtcolor-00479d {
  color: #00479d;
}
.txtcolor-747474{
	color: #747474;
}

.border-color-e1e1e1 {
  border-color: #e1e1e1 !important;
}

.border-color-3e87df {
  border-color: #3e87df !important;
}

.sosobtn {
  background: var(--main-color);
}

.language:hover .languageon {
  color: var(--main-color);
}

.languageabs a:hover {
  background: var(--main-color);
  color: #fff;
}

.gallery-thumbs .swiper-slide-thumb-active img {
  opacity: 1;
  border: 1px var(--main-color) solid;
}

.navbox a i {
  color: #ccc;
}

.navbox a:hover i, .navbox a.on, .navbox a.on i {
  color: #fff;
  background: #004898;
  padding: 0 23px;
  border-radius: 17px;
}

.navbox .lt .harsublink{
	background: #ffffff;
}

.navbox .lt .harsublink .title{
	color: #737373;
}

.navbox .lt .harsublink .clt:hover .title,
.navbox .lt .harsublink .clt.on .title{
	color: var(--main-color);
}

.navbox .lt .harsublink .clt:hover::after,
.navbox .lt .harsublink .clt.on::after{
	background: var(--main-color);
}

.indexswiper {
  margin-top: -89px;
}
.indexswiper.nobanner{
	margin-top: initial;
}

.indexswiper .swiper-button-next:hover, .indexswiper .swiper-button-prev:hover {
  background: #004898;
  border-color: #004898;
}

.indexswiper .swiper-pagination-bullet {
  color: #fff;
}

.indexswiper .swiper-pagination-bullet-active {
  color: var(--main-color);
}

.indexswiper .swiper-slide img {
  width: 100%;
  display: block;
  margin: 0 auto;
}

.indexswiper .swiper-slide img.mobile {
  display: none;
}

#type .swiper-button-next, #type .swiper-button-prev {
  color: #ccc;
}

#type .swiper-button-next:hover, #type .swiper-button-prev:hover {
  color: var(--main-color);
}

.swipertype .swiper-slide a:hover p {
  color: var(--main-color);
  font-weight: bold;
}

.indexbox1 {
  background: #f1f1f1  center bottom no-repeat;
}

.box1btn:hover {
  color: #ffffff;
  background: var(--main-color);
}

.box2right h3 {
  color: var(--main-color);
}

.indexnews a.item:hover {
  background: var(--main-color);
}

.indexnews a.item:hover p {
  color: #fff;
}

.indexnews a.item:hover::after {
  background: var(--main-color);
}

.indexnews .itemgd:hover i {
  color: #fff;
  background: var(--main-color);
}

.indexnews .itemgd:hover p {
  color: #fff;
}

.alswiper .swiper-button-next, .alswiper .swiper-button-prev {
  color: #fff;
  background: var(--main-color);
}

.alswiper .swiper-slide:hover .abs {
  color: #fff !important;
}

.albtn:hover {
  color: #fff;
  background: var(--main-color);
  border-color: var(--main-color) !important;
}

.footnav a {
  color: #818181;
}

.footnav a:hover {
  color: #ffffff;
}

.copy a:hover {
  color: #fff;
}

.copy a {
  display: inline-block;
  margin-left: 6px;
}

.pagebread h2 {
  border-left: 3px var(--main-color) solid;
}

.lcdl:hover {
  color: #fff;
  background: var(--main-color);
}

.lcdl:hover .txtcolor-818181 {
  color: #fff;
}

.lcgdbtn:hover, .lcgdbtn:hover .txtcolor-818181 {
  color: var(--main-color);
}

.aboutbox h1 {
  color: #333;
}

.vlist li a {
  background: #f6f6f6;
}

.vlist li a:hover {
  background: var(--main-color);
}

.vlist li a:hover h3, .vlist li a:hover p {
  color: #fff;
}

.page a:hover, .page a.on {
  color: #fff;
  background: var(--main-color);
  border-color: var(--main-color);
}

.yiji li a.inactive:hover, .yiji li a.inactive:hover i, .yiji li a.inactive.inactives i, .yiji li a.inactive.inactives {
  color: var(--main-color);
}

.sublast li a:hover, .sublast li.on a {
  color: var(--main-color) !important;
  text-decoration: underline;
}

.yiji li   li {
  border-top: 1px #e5e5e5 solid;
}

.sublast li a {
  color: #818181;
}

.yiji li a.inactive i {
  color: #ccc;
}

.leftnav h2 {
  border-bottom: 2px #ccc solid;
}

.lxrbox h2::after {
  background: var(--main-color);
}

.leftnav {
  border: 1px #ccc solid;
}

.rylist a {
  background: #f6f6f6;
}

.pagesobox {
  background: var(--main-color);
}

.ditem {
  background: #f6f6f6;
}

.ditem:hover {
  background: var(--main-color);
}

.ditem:hover h3 {
  color: #fff;
}

.ditem:hover .dinfos {
  color: #fff;
}

.ditem:hover .dbtns {
  color: #fff;
  background: var(--main-color);
}

.ditem:hover .border-color-e1e1e1 {
  border-color: #fff !important;
}

.qaitem {
  background: #f6f6f6;
}

.qaitem:hover {
  background: var(--main-color);
}

.qaitem:hover span {
  color: #fff;
}

.qaitem:hover h3, .qaitem:hover div {
  color: #fff;
}

.nitem:hover {
  background: var(--main-color);
}

.nitem:hover h2, .nitem:hover div {
  color: #fff;
}

.nitem:hover .border-color-e1e1e1 {
  border-color: #fff !important;
}

.rabs a:hover {
  background: var(--main-color);
  color: #fff;
}

.rabs a .abs {
  background: var(--main-color);
  color: #fff;
}

.rabs .abs3 {
  background: var(--main-color);
}

.rabs .abs2 {
  background: var(--main-color);
}

.rylist a:hover {
  background: var(--main-color);
}

.rylist a:hover p {
  color: #fff;
}

.cpul li a {
  border: 1px #ccc solid;
}

.cpul li a:hover {
  border-color: #fff;
  box-shadow: 0 0 20px rgba(0, 0, 0, 0.1);
}

.cpul li a:hover .cptitle {
  color: #333;
}

.cptitle {
  border-bottom: 1px #e1e1e1 solid;
}

.cpul li a:hover .cpgd {
  color: #fff !important;
  background: var(--main-color);
}

.cppage {
  background: #f7f7f7;
}

.xbox .swiper-button-next:after, .xbox .swiper-button-prev:after {
  color: var(--main-color);
}

.cppager h1 {
  border-bottom: 1px #e1e1e1 solid;
}

.cpcsbtn a {
  background: var(--main-color);
  color: #fff;
}

.cpcsbtn a:hover {
  color: #fff;
}

.sosotab a.on {
  border-bottom: 3px var(--main-color) solid;
}

.allist .v-txt .abs {
  background: var(--main-color);
}

.allist li a:hover .abs {
  background: #fff;
  color: var(--main-color);
}

.alswiperbox {
  background: #f6f6f6;
}

.alswiperbox .swiper-button-next:hover, .alswiperbox .swiper-button-prev:hover {
  background: var(--main-color);
  color: #fff;
}

.soinput i {
  color: var(--main-color);
}

a:hover {
  text-decoration: none;
  color: #00479d;
}

.indexproductswiper .proitem .icon{
	 background: var(--main-color);
}

.indexproductswiper .proitem .icon .iconfont{
	color: #ffffff;
	font-size: 20px;
}</pre></body></html>